First American Financial Corporation (FAF) delivers financial services primarily through its diverse subsidiaries. The company's operations are divided into two main divisions: Title Insurance and Services, and Specialty Insurance. The Title Insurance and Services division is a prominent issuer of title insurance policies for both residential and commercial properties. Beyond core insurance, this segment provides a broad spectrum of related offerings aimed at streamlining real estate transactions and reducing associated risks. First American Financial remains undervalued at a 10x forward P/E and offers a well-covered 3% dividend yield. FAF's commercial segment drove 15% YoY revenue growth, with record ARPO and expanding trust and 1031 exchange deposits. AI-driven platforms like Endpoint and Sequoia are delivering measurable productivity gains, supporting margin expansion and future competitive advantage.

FAF faces residential pressure from high mortgage rates, but strong commercial title activity and investment income offer support.
